Island. ' The annual sale of work of St. Stephen's Church, Lower Hutt, is to be held on Friday next, in the church room, Woburn road. The Moderator of the Presbytery, the Rev. R. S. Watson, M.C., M.A., will officially open the sale at 2.30 p.m. Stalls include beautiful spring flowers, produce, home-made cakes, sweets, and kitchen requirements, and a bran tub for the children. In the evening musical items and competitions are the main features, and a good evening's enjoyment is promised. i
